Key Ingredients in Sparkling Water: Minerals, Acids, and Additives

Two hundred milligrams of magnesium. That is the difference between a pleasant afternoon and a hasty exit from a Johannesburg boardroom. Most people never inspect the mineral profile on their sparkling water label. They assume the fizz causes the trouble. They are often wrong. The actual connection between sparkling water and diarrhea depends on what the manufacturer puts inside the bottle.

The acids come first. Carbon dioxide dissolves under pressure to form carbonic acid, which drops the pH to roughly 3.5. This mild acidity sets off a familiar sequence. The stomach produces extra gastric juice, the pyloric valve opens earlier, and the small intestine receives a larger liquid load. We covered that reflex earlier. But carbonic acid is not the only acid in the drink. Many flavoured sparkling waters contain citric acid, which is far more irritating to a delicate gut lining.

The mineral content carries its own weight. South African brands draw from different aquifers, and the magnesium concentration can range from negligible to 100 mg per litre. Magnesium acts as an osmotic agent. It pulls water from the bloodstream into the gut, increasing stool volume and softening consistency. When we isolate the variables in sparkling water and diarrhea, the mineral content emerges as a stronger predictor than carbonation. Researchers have documented this effect in healthy volunteers.

Then there are the additives. A plain carbonated water requires only water and CO2. The flavoured versions change everything. Read the label and you will typically find:

  • Citric acid, which adds tartness and can provoke gastric cramps
  • Potassium bicarbonate, a pH regulator associated with colonic fluid shifts
  • Sorbitol or erythritol, sugar alcohols that are poorly absorbed and draw water into the large intestine
  • Sucralose, a sweetener that alters microbial balance in the colon
  • Sodium citrate, which interferes with normal electrolyte absorption

Sorbitol deserves particular attention. Ten grams of this sugar alcohol can cause explosive diarrhoea in a healthy person. A standard 500 ml bottle of sweetened sparkling water can deliver that amount in one sitting. This is the hidden mechanism inside sparkling water and diarrhea cases that have nothing to do with carbonation itself.

The clinical picture becomes clearer when you consider the additive and the mineral together. A low-mineral, unsweetened sparkling water may produce no digestive upset whatsoever. Swap to a magnesium-rich, sorbitol-sweetened variant and the whole pelvic floor reacts within an hour. That variability is why we cannot treat sparkling water and diarrhea as a single verdict. The individual bottle dictates the response. The sensitivity of your gut determines the severity.

High Magnesium or Sodium Content and Osmotic Effects

Some still waters hide a sharper edge. When examining the link between sparkling water and diarrhea, the mineral profile deserves as much scrutiny as the gas itself. Certain bottled brands, particularly those sourced from deep springs, carry a significant load of magnesium and sodium. These minerals do not simply pass through the body silently; they exert a measurable osmotic pull.

This means water is drawn into the intestinal lumen to balance the concentration of minerals, which can rapidly soften stool and accelerate transit time. The effect is not psychological. It is a physical reaction to the solute load in the drink.

– Magnesium sulfate, often present in high-mineral waters, acts as a gentle but effective cathartic.
– Sodium citrate can trigger bile acid malabsorption in susceptible individuals.
– The combination of both minerals and carbonation can compound the laxative effect.

Your gut reacts to the total osmotic pressure of everything you consume. A bottle of sparkling water with a high mineral content might be the single input that pushes a sensitive bowel over the threshold, turning a refreshing sip into a cause of sparkling water and diarrhea. The reaction depends entirely on concentration and individual tolerance.

When Diarrhea Becomes Cause for Concern

Most of us pay little attention to a single loose stool. The body flushes the irritant and returns to its normal rhythm. Sparkling water and diarrhea usually follow this arc: one episode, then relief. Concern starts when the pattern refuses to break.

Red flags separate a passing reaction from a genuine problem:

  • Stools that stay loose for more than three days
  • Blood or mucus in the stool
  • Fever above 38°C
  • Severe abdominal pain that does not ease

Dehydration compounds the risk, especially in the South African summer. Dry mouth, dark urine, dizziness, and a racing pulse mean the gut is losing more than water. If sparkling water and diarrhea appear together with any red flag, stop the carbonation and contact a healthcare provider.

Reading Labels for Hidden Sweeteners and Acids

Nearly half of all sugar free beverages contain sugar alcohols, and those are the same compounds that can send your bowels into a frenzy. Sorbitol, erythritol, and xylitol are common in flavored sparkling water. The body absorbs them poorly, leaving them to ferment in the colon. That fermentation draws water into the gut. The result can be loose stools, especially if you sip several cans in a day. The connection between sparkling water and diarrhea is often invisible. It hides inside the “zero calorie” promise printed on the label.

Look for the quiet offenders first. Acids are not always listed as their actual name. Citric acid might appear as “natural flavor.” Phosphoric acid can hide behind a fruity moniker. These acids shift the pH of the water to a level that irritates a sensitive stomach lining. For a person already prone to gut sensitivity, one bottle can tip the balance.

– Check for “sucralose” or “acesulfame potassium” on the back label.
– Search for “added citric acid” in the ingredient panel.
– Note whether it says “natural flavor” and “no sweeteners” together. That combination often masks a proprietary mixture of acids.

The cleanest route is to choose a plain carbonated water, then add a squeeze of fresh lemon yourself. Your stomach will thank you for the absence of chemical additives. The bubbles remain, but the irritation disappears. That simple trade lets you keep your habit while giving your digestive tract a break. Reading labels for hidden sweeteners and acids takes thirty seconds and can prevent a full day of discomfort. The relationship between sparkling water and diarrhea rarely comes from the carbon dioxide, but it frequently stems from the ingredients packed around it.

Keeping a Beverage and Symptom Diary

If you want to understand your own pattern of sparkling water and diarrhea, the unglamorous diary becomes your finest instrument. Do not rely on memory. Memory softens edges and invents false correlations. Write everything down while it is still fresh, and do this for at least two weeks before you draw any personal conclusions.

Each entry needs to capture more than just which can or bottle you finished. Pour sizes matter, as does the temperature of the drink. Record whether the bottle was freshly opened or had sat for an hour with the cap loosened. Note the time of day and what else was in your stomach. A fizzy drink on an empty gut behaves differently from one consumed after a meal of avocado toast or oats. Your entries should also describe bowel urgency and stool consistency, ranked simply on a scale from one to five, with one being solid and five being watery. This gives you a rough but usable scale for spotting trouble.

– Exact brand and flavor of the sparkling water
– Approximate volume consumed in milliliters
– Stillness or carbonation level, if known
– Time between the last sip and your first symptom
– Any other foods consumed within two hours before or after

The diary serves one main purpose. It separates the true trigger from the passing coincidence. You might discover that only citrus-flavored varieties upset you, while plain mineral water passes through without incident. Alternatively, you could find that the issue is volume, not bubbles. A full 500 milliliter bottle drunk quickly may cause cramping, while the same amount consumed slowly across an hour leaves you calm. These distinctions are invisible without a written record, but they become obvious once the data is in front of you.

After two weeks, review your notes with honest eyes. You are looking for patterns that repeat, not isolated incidents. If sparkling water and diarrhea appear together three times out of four whenever you drink a particular brand, that brand is likely your problem. If the pattern holds regardless of brand, then carbonation itself may be the issue, and your diary has just saved you from months of unnecessary experimentation. The record turns guesswork into a quiet, reliable map of your own digestive limits, and that map is what allows you to enjoy bubbles again without the fear of consequence.
